曙光5000刀片服务器KVM系统设计与实现

来源 :中国科学院计算技术研究所 | 被引量 : 0次 | 上传用户:longxue1211
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着技术的进步,由商用部件构成的、成本低廉的机群系统已经成为高性能计算应用的主流。但是,机群系统计算密度低、体积大、能耗高,可靠性差,很大程度上制约了自身的发展。刀片服务器是一种高计算密度、低能耗、高可靠性的新型机群系统,它较好地解决了传统机群系统固有的问题,对高性能计算的发展普及产生了深远的影响。   本文以曙光5000A新一代节点、曙光公司第二代刀片服务器TC3600为平台,开发了DRKVM(Dawning Remote KVM)远程控制系统,对刀片服务器的远程监控管理做了一定的探索。本文的主要工作如下:   1、分析了国内外机群系统远程监控技术的发展状态,结合曙光TC3600刀片服务器的特点,设计了数字式KVM系统-DRKVM。DRKVM是一个基于SoC芯片的远程监控系统,它使用软硬件结合的方法,给管理员提供了通过TCP/IP网络监控刀片机群的能力。   2、基于C/S架构开发了DRKVM系统。DRKVM由两个子系统组成,分别实现了键盘鼠标重定向和视频重定向功能。键盘鼠标重定向子系统负责将管理端的键盘鼠标事件映射到被管理刀片上;视频重定向子系统负责处理被管理刀片的显卡输出,并将处理过的视频通过TCP/IP网络发送到管理端。主要开发工作包括硬件原理图设计、驱动软件、逻辑软件、网络通信软件的编写与调试。   3、对DRKVM系统进行了测试与评价。测试工作主要包括功能验证和性能测试。为了兼容不同的网络情况,本文在三种网络状况下(10M/100M/1000M)对DRKVM系统进行了性能测试,并且提出了在较差网络条件下的自适应措施。实验结果表明,DRKVM系统完全能够满足TC3600刀片服务器的管理需求,具有一定的可扩展性和自适应性。   本课题对于刀片服务器的远程监控管理具有一定的指导意义和参考价值,同时,本课题的成果也可以作为模拟式KVM的数字化模块,给传统机群的远程监控管理提供解决方案。
其他文献
随着成像技术的发展,产生了海量的生物医学图像,使用传统的串行计算方式已经无法满足大量生物医学图像数据的处理需求,因此,需要高性能计算技术来加速生物医学图像数据的并行处理
目前,大多数安全访问控制技术都是基于操作系统实现的,如SELinux。而在虚拟化环境下,访问控制技术通常都是在虚拟化层(Hypervisor或VMM)实现的。不论操作系统,还是虚拟化层,其安全
人群疏散模拟作为广泛应用于建筑疏散评估、群体行为演练、影视制作等方面的新兴研究热点,如何能够实现高效的人群路径规划和复杂行为建模已经成为了众多国内外研究者的重大
龙芯2号作为中科院计算技术研究所自主研发的高性能通用处理器,从其诞生之日起就和国家信息化、工业化等紧密联系到了一起,应用的范围也越来越广泛,数字信号处理领域就是其中之
随着Web技术的发展,许多信息都以服务的方式发布到网络上。一种新的利用这些信息服务构建某个领域的信息展示类应用的方式应运而生,即面向领域的信息聚合展示类Mashup应用。然
随着信息科技的发展,大量的数据被生产出来,并逐渐成为各个企业组织的重要资产。数据的丢失往往会带来重大的经济损失,甚至威胁到企业的生存。全球每年都会发生因为数据丢失造成
博客(web blog)是Web2.0的典型应用之一。博客通过提供作者与读者的交流平台而构建出交互式和动态更新的社会网络,已成为一种重要的信息传播媒介。博客的形式多样、内容灵活,极
随着GIS应用的不断发展,GIS数据出现了激增的趋势,现有使用文件系统、数据库的数据管理方法遇到了处理和存储能力的瓶颈。使用集群系统管理和处理GIS数据将成为高性能GIS应用的
机器人足球系统是一个新型的交叉学科,是一个典型的分布式人工多智能体系统,在这个系统中,多个智能体,即机器人小车,在复杂的场地环境中相互协同配合完成任务。机器人足球系统涉及
随着计算机技术在工作和生活中扮演越来越重要的角色,对儿童的计算机科学的教育越来越受到国内外研究人员的重视。编程教育已经被证实可以激发儿童对计算机科学的兴趣,培养儿童